What Is C2P2?


The Coal Combustion Products Partnership (C2P2) program is a cooperative effort between EPA and the American Coal Ash Association (ACAA), Utility Solid Waste Activities Group (USWAG), Department of Energy (DOE), Federal Highway Administration (FHWA), the Electric Power Research Institute (EPRI), and the United States Department of Agriculture Agricultural Research Service (USDA-ARS) to promote the beneficial use of coal combustion products (CCPs) and the environmental benefits that result from their use.

What are Coal Combustion Products?

CCPs are the byproducts generated from burning coal in coal-fired power plants. These byproducts include fly ash, bottom ash, boiler slag, and flue gas desulfurization gypsum.

What Are the Benefits of Using CCPs and Why Did EPA Create C2P2?

There are numerous environmental, economic, and performance benefits that result from using CCPs which is why EPA formed the C2P2 program.

Environmental benefits can include reduced greenhouse gas emissions, reduced land disposal requirements, and reduced utilization of virgin resources.

Economic benefits can include reduced costs associated with coal ash and slag disposal, increased revenue from the sale of CCPs, and savings from using CCPs in place of other, more costly materials.

Performance benefits
can result from the physical and chemical characteristics of CCPs and include greater resistance to chemical attack, increased strength, and improved workability. For instance, high fly ash-content concrete can be used for high performance, long-life pavements which are designed to last 50 years—twice the lifetime of conventional pavements.

Specific benefits may vary depending on the properties of CCPs and the applications for their use.

C2P2 Partners

Like EPA’s WasteWise program, C2P2 promotes and recognizes participants for their voluntary efforts. By joining the C2P2 program, organizations agree to work to increase the beneficial use of CCPs, and in return are eligible for awards recognizing their activities and achievements, such as documented increases in CCP use and success stories in CCP promotion and utilization.

Education & Outreach

One of the most important functions of C2P2 is to support educational and technical outreach about the safe and beneficial use of CCPs. This outreach may be in the form of workshops, conferences, public appearances, conference calls, networking, and other means of information sharing, and often combines information from FHWA, EPA, DOE, ACAA, EPRA, USDA-ARS, and other sources to provide a comprehensive look at the beneficial use of CCPs.
